About Betty Zenk

Betty Zenk is an experienced professional in operations and revenue cycle management, currently working at Warbird Consulting Partners, LLC since 2019. She has held various roles in healthcare organizations, including positions at Navigant, Mercy Health, and The University of Toledo.

Previous Experience at Navigant

Before joining Warbird Consulting Partners, Betty Zenk worked at Navigant as an Executive Account Manager from 2017 to 2019. Based in Chicago, Illinois, she held this position for two years, where she managed client accounts and provided strategic insights to improve healthcare operations.

Career Progression in Healthcare

Betty Zenk's career in healthcare began at Promedica, where she worked as Central Billing Office Manager from 1999 to 2007. She then transitioned to The University of Toledo, where she held roles as Manager of Patient Access and later as Project Manager in Revenue Cycle.
